Showing Percentage of Patients Referred and Admitted to a Hospital Within 3 Days
In this article, we will discuss how to calculate the percentage of patients who were referred and admitted to a hospital within 3 days. This is important for healthcare providers to monitor patient flow and ensure timely care.
Patient Referral and Admission Data
To begin, we need to have access to patient referral and admission data. This data should include the following information for each patient:
- Referral date
- Admission date
- Referring hospital
- Admitting hospital
Calculating the Total Wait Time
To calculate the total wait time for each patient, we need to subtract the referral date from the admission date. This will give us the number of days between the two dates.
total\_wait\_time = admission\_date - referral\_date
Calculating the Percentage of Patients Admitted Within 3 Days
To calculate the percentage of patients who were admitted within 3 days, we need to filter the data to only include patients who were admitted within that time frame. We can then divide the number of patients who were admitted within 3 days by the total number of patients, and multiply by 100 to get the percentage.
patients\_admitted\_within\_3\_days = len(data[data['total\_wait\_time'] <= 3])
percentage\_admitted\_within\_3\_days = (patients\_admitted\_within\_3\_days / len(data)) \* 100
